On 14 July 2022, ASLM’s LabCoP convened a webinar about the Rapid Test Continuous Quality Improvement (RT-CQI) initiative developed by PEPFAR and the US Centre for Disease Control and Prevention. In partnership with other stakeholders, it supports the strengthening of capacity and ongoing assessment of facility and individual tester competency in performing rapid tests. Given the often-high number of facilities that conduct rapid testing (sometimes multiple testing sites within the same facility), and individual testers, digital solutions have a potential to provide reliable real-time information in progress to field staff, managers, implementers, and governments. In this session, Dr Tim Tucker, Adjunct Associate Professor at the University of Cape Town School of Public Health and CEO of SEAD Consulting; Ms Makhosazana (Khosi) Makhanya, Senior Public Health Specialist-Laboratory Advisor, US CDC, South Africa; and Prof Alash’le Abimiku, Executive Director, International Research Center of Excellence at the Institute of Human Virology-Nigeria, discussed the implementation of an innovative solution for RT-CQI program in South Africa, the benefits from the funding agency, and implementing partners perspectives respectively.
